This page lists concept art and unused content for the game Growtopia. There are also earlier ideas for the game. These concepts began production in 2012, several months before the game's launch in 2013.

Early Name

Before the game came out, ex-developers Seth Able Robinson and Mike Hommel came up with the original name Buildo. Ultimately, however, the name Growtopia was chosen, as Buildo was already used as the name of a series of sticker book apps.

Concept Art

As seen in earlier concept art for the game, the concept of growing trees was already designed to be a key mechanic in the game, although at that time trees weren't meant to drop items when harvested, for they dropped consumable berries instead.

These mock-up screenshots were originally made by Seth using stolen ripped sprites. They were presented to his fellow indie developer Mike Hommel, better known as his alias Hamumu, to convince him to join the project.

Earlier Gameplay

As seen in earlier screenshots of the game, the Wrench had red borders. A message was also sent in the player's chat when they selected an item in their inventory.
